Step 1: Water Extraction
We’ll use powerful pumps and vacuums to remove standing water from your property. Our technicians are trained to identify the source of the leak and take steps to prevent further damage.
Step 2: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use specialized equipment to dry out your home, including dehumidifiers and air movers. Our goal is to remove excess moisture and prevent further damage.
Step 3: Sanitizing and Disinfecting
We’ll use EPA-registered disinfectants to sanitize and disinfect your home, removing any bacteria, viruses, or other contaminants.
Step 4: Reconstruction and Repair
Once your home is dry and clean, our team will work with you to repair or replace any damaged materials, including drywall, flooring, and cabinetry.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Completion
We’ll conduct a thorough final inspection to ensure that your home is safe and secure. We’ll also provide you with a comprehensive report outlining the work we’ve done and any recommendations for future maintenance.

Residential Water Damage Restoration Cost in Firebaugh, CA
The cost of Residential Water Damage Restoration in Firebaugh, CA can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Our estimates are based on a range of factors, including the amount of water involved, the type of materials damaged, and the complexity of the repair.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water involved and complexity of extraction |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area and type of materials involved |
| Sanitizing and Disinfecting |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of contamination and type of surfaces involved |
| Reconstruction and Rep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Complexity of repair and type of materials involved |
| Final Inspection and Completion |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and complexity of inspection |

Common Questions About Residential Water Damage Restoration
What is the average cost of Residential Water Damage Restoration?
The average cost of Residential Water Damage Restoration can range from $2,000 to $10,000, depending on the severity and size of the affected area.
How long does it take to complete a Residential Water Damage Restoration job?
The length of time it takes to complete a Residential Water Damage Restoration job can vary depending on the size of the affected area and the complexity of the repair. On average, it can take anywhere from 3 to 7 days to complete a job.
Do I need to have insurance to get Residential Water Damage Restoration?
Yes, having insurance is highly recommended to cover the cost of Residential Water Damage Restoration. Our team will work closely with your insurance company to ensure that you get the compensation you deserve.
Can I do Residential Water Damage Restoration myself?
No, it’s not recommended to try to do Residential Water Damage Restoration yourself. Water damage can be unpredictable and need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and ensure a safe environment.
How do I prevent water damage in my home?
To prevent water damage in your home, make sure to regularly inspect your pipes, appliances, and roof for any signs of leaks or damage. Also, ensure that your home is properly ventilated and that you have a working sump pump and backup power source.
